Jim Ryan        Jim Ryan

        Agua Solutions International, S.A. 
        President/Founder

Jim Ryan began his career in the water industry upon graduating from Stanford University and beginning work at ADS (American Digital Systems, Inc.). ADS was a NASA ‘spin-off’ technology company formed by the German scientist responsible for telemetry on the Gemini & Apollo projects. ADS designed, built and operated networks of remote mini-computers with sensors to provide local governments and municipalities with real time environmental and hydrological data (analysis of rainfall, storm water, waste water, industrial effluent and river flows) in order to aid the design of appropriate water treatment facilities.
   By pursuing his twin passions for water and the latest technological advancements, Jim quickly rose to the position of President of the company’s multi-million dollar Long Term Water Monitoring Division, the company’s largest and most profitable group.   

  This early focus upon water and the environment was the basis for Jim’s work in the legislative, regulatory and commercial aspects of providing water and energy supplies to large multi-national industrial clients such as Alcoa, GE, Pfizer, Ford Motor, Pepsi, Smucker’s Foods, Reynolds Metals, Dana Corporation, Timken Steel, Rohm & Haas Chemical, Sun Oil and British Petroleum.

The lure of Europe’s newly emerging competitive utility markets prompted Jim to establish one of Europe’s very first private utility supply & consultancy companies in 1992. After nine years of working in Europe, and having sold the successful company to a large utility conglomerate, Jim left London in 2001 to visit Costa Rica for a week’s holiday (sunshine!). However, instead of returning to London, Jim stayed to explore the region’s diverse flora & fauna and enjoy its natural beauty...and while experiencing his first dry season recognized the challenge and opportunity to introduce sustainable water supply technologies to the region in the forms of Rain Water Harvesting, advanced purification systems, etc.

Before forming Agua Solutions International, Jim had lived and worked in the USA, UK, Italy, Hungary, aboard a sailboat and most recently in Costa Rica & Nicaragua. He has also completed projects in Australia, Sweden, Norway, Russia (Siberia) and Poland, besides traveling much of the world in search of new sailing, scuba diving or windsurfing experiences. Jim now resides in Liberia, Costa Rica where Agua Solutions International’s Central American offices are based.

Jim is a member of ARCSA (The North American Rainwater Catchment Systems Association) and the International Rainwater Harvesting Alliance (IRHA), which includes the Blue Schools Programme.

Terry Ryan Kane

        Terry Ryan Kane D.V.M., M.S.
        Development Director – Energy & Humanitarian Projects

Terry grew up in Nebraska and Colorado and like her brother, Jim, learned to love the prairie wind and the mountain waters. She learned to fly airplanes in that windy region of the country and now pilots her own small plane.
                    
Her education in the sciences, and her curiosity, have taken her to many regions of the world. She received her undergraduate degrees in Biology and Chemistry in New York City, earned a Master’s of Science in Ecology from the University of Illinois in Chicago and went on to receive her Doctorate of Veterinary Medicine at the University of Illinois in Champaign-Urbana. This has led to many conservation projects in such places as Africa, Mexico, and Central America, including work with marine mammals and sea turtles. She also works and trains in disaster medicine, living and working in austere or even hazardous environments.
 
This aspect of Public Health has helped focus her interest in disease prevention and availability of safe water for people and animals. Having worked for almost two months in New Orleans immediately after Hurricane Katrina struck, Terry knows first hand the challenges which arise when water scarcity and natural disaster combine.

Her experience with aviation (instrument rating with USA & Costa Rica licenses) has combined her love of wind and weather with the global need for sustainable energy. When her brother founded Agua Solutions and ASI Power & Telemetry, combining renewable water and energy resources, she decided to pitch in and help.

Terry has 5 grown sons who like to travel with her and all of them are bilingual. She is still learning.

Pamela Gomez        Pamela Gómez Obando
        Administrative Assistant

Pamela was born and raised in Cartago. She began her education there and showed an early inclination for mathematics. She graduated initially as a private accountant.

However, she has always loved the natural environment, learning about living organisms, their biology and physiology. Her interests in science, nature and the environment led her to further her science education. She attended the Technology Institute of Costa Rica to study biotechnology and pursue a new career path.

While pursuing her science education in biotechnology she participated in many projects. One interesting study was to investigate a bacteria, Bacillus thuringiensis. This bacteria was isolated from the larvae of Aedes aegypti,  the mosquito responsible for Dengue Fever transmission. This research focused on utilizing this bacteria as a larvicide to control this mosquitoe’s reproduction and reduce the spread of this terrible disease.

Also, during a part of 2006, she worked in Language Line Services as a “Costumer Service Interpreter”, which gave her a chance to refine her language skills.

Currently she lives in Liberia where she enjoys sharing her time with her family, traveling to new places and reading.
